Destination Server-Groups Server-groups give administrators the ability to configure multiple destinations (session-targets) on the same VOIP dial-peer. By default, the sort order is the preference defined in the server-group entries. Round-robin hunting can be employed when you use the command hunt-scheme round-robin. Server-Groups were added in Cisco IOS 15.4(1)T and Cisco IOS XE 3.11S. In Cisco IOS XE 17.4.1a configurable huntstop error codes was added to voice class-server group configurations. That is, you can configure a single error code, say 404 Not Found, and SIP error would normally trigger the device to try the next option in the server- group. With the config huntstop 1 resp-code 404 in place within the the server-group; hunting can stop. These can also be configured for a range like: huntstop 1 resp-code 401 to 599.
